You can buy small trees for around $20 each, or raise them from scratch. WebBrasa, Minneapolis & St. Paul. Though Alex Robert’s menu is an ode to the South, the ingredients are all about the Midwest. Nearly 100 percent of Brasa’s meat, dairy, eggs, flour, sweet corn and cornmeal come from small farms throughout Minnesota, Wisconsin and Iowa.
